Cleaned up Menu API

This commit is contained in:
Auxilor
2022-11-08 18:11:27 +00:00
parent d3a7ef72e8
commit d5ddcaea4b
5 changed files with 29 additions and 11 deletions

View File

@@ -70,7 +70,7 @@ class GUIListener(private val plugin: EcoPlugin) : Listener {
val (row, column) = MenuUtils.convertSlotToRowColumn(event.slot, menu.columns)
menu.getSlot(row, column, player, menu).handle(player, event, menu)
menu.getSlot(row, column, player).handle(player, event, menu)
}
@EventHandler(
@@ -93,7 +93,7 @@ class GUIListener(private val plugin: EcoPlugin) : Listener {
val (row, column) = MenuUtils.convertSlotToRowColumn(inv.firstEmpty(), menu.columns)
val slot = menu.getSlot(row, column, player, menu)
val slot = menu.getSlot(row, column, player)
if (!slot.isCaptive(player, menu)) {
event.isCancelled = true